20120002588 | SYSTEM AND METHOD FOR PROVIDING MOBILITY MANAGEMENT AND OUT-OF-COVERAGE INDICATION IN A CONVENTIONAL LAND MOBILE RADIO SYSTEM - The present disclosure provides a system and a method for providing mobility management and out-of-coverage indication in a conventional Land Mobile Radio (LMR) system. A radio provides its location and user group data to the disclosed system through its traffic channel when the channel is idle. Knowledge of the radio's current location and user group data is used to provide dynamic call routing and data management within the disclosed system. The disclosed system and method may provide operability similar to that of a trunking system by providing mobility management and out-of-coverage indication while providing low-cost benefits through operation of a conventional system. | 01-05-2012 |
20120039201 | HYBRID LAND MOBILE RADIO SYSTEM INCORPORATING MOBILITY MANAGEMENT AND OUT-OF-COVERAGE INDICATION - The present disclosure provides a system and a method for providing mobility management and out-of-coverage indication in a hybrid system comprised of conventional LMR sites and trunking LMR sites. If a radio is located at a conventional site, the radio provides its location and user group data to the disclosed system through its traffic channel when the channel is idle. If the radio is located at a trunking site, the radio provides its location and user group data to the disclosed system through the trunking site's control channel. Knowledge of the radio's current location and user group data is used to provide dynamic call routing and data management within the disclosed system. The disclosed system and method provides seamless communication between a trunking site and a conventional site while concurrently enhancing the hybrid system to provide mobility management and out-of-coverage indication features typically associated with a stand-alone trunking system. | 02-16-2012 |
